There are certain circumstances when employers are required to follow the code of practice:
- when staff are transferred from an NHS body to a private service provider, or
- in cases when staff originally transferred out as a result of an outsourcing. are TUPE transferred to a new provider when a contract is re-tendered.
This Code (last amended in 2005) should form part of the service specification and conditions for all such contracts.
Agenda for Change and soft facilities management contracts
In October 2005, NHS Employers endorsed a joint statement with the Department of Health, trade unions and representatives of private contractors that aims to give staff working on outsourced soft facilities management (soft FM) contracts (for example porters and cleaners) pay and conditions equivalent to Agenda for Change.
